Students arrested for criminal offenses at universities will they directly lose property The student for two years, will not wait for the university the ruling of justice, government spokesman Pavlos Marinakis told SKAI, referring to the relevant announcements to the Minister of Education Sofia Zacharakis from the Rectors.

He explained that if a court ruling was followed and the student was acquitted, then his status would come back. However, if convicted, it will lose it permanently.

About deterioration or destruction University property by a student, Mr. Marinakis made it clear: “You broke, you will pay, and if you do not pay the fine immediately it will go to the VAT.” As he made it clear, this is something that will be legislated immediately.

The government spokesman stressed that now are clearly described and the consequences Where will university governors have if they do not apply the law, saying that the sanctions will be equivalent to those of a hospital administrator.

He explained that the security planning that universities must submit not only concerns issues of violence but also civil protection, for example fire extinguishers and escape exits.

For the University Police, he noted that those who were hired to staff them do not sit down, working normally in other services, and even because of their training they also participate in businesses in universities.
